This contract involves providing hands-on operational and maintenance training to government personnel on the use, safety protocols, and basic troubleshooting of an automated gate system. The training is designed to equip the staff with the necessary skills to effectively operate and maintain the automated security equipment, ensuring both operational efficiency and safety compliance. The effort is set to take place on-site in Gulfport, with the Department of Defense's W7NH Uspfo Activity Msang Crtc serving as the contracting agency. The solicitation is a total small business set-aside under FAR 19.5, aligning with NAICS code 611430, which pertains to professional and management development training. The contract type is a subcontract, with the response deadline set for July 1, 2026. This opportunity aims to support government readiness by enhancing the technical capabilities of its personnel through targeted instructional delivery and practical application training on the automated gate system.
